When encountering a sparse string buffer, Vela fails
both due to missing a mapping for a Numpy string type
and also for not being able to read sparse buffers.
The failing line is attempting to reshape a [100]
buffer into a [3, 5] tensor which does not work due
to Vela treating the buffer as non-sparse.
The solution here is to simply not do the reshape
for string buffers (which all appear to be sparse)
since it is not something that will be supported in
the future anyway.
The related operator can then be pushed to the CPU
as expected.

This patch adds support for the ResizeBilinear operator.
It is implemented using a 2x2 Nearest Neighbor upscale
followed by a 2x2 Average Pool.
Depending on the argument align_corners
the output is either of shape:
- (2 * M, 2 * N) when align_corners == True, or
- (2 * M - 1, 2 * N - 1) when align_corners == False
where (M, N) is the input shape.
The padding mode is SAME when align_corners == True
and VALID when align_corners == False.
The argument half_pixel_centers is out of scope and is
as of now ignored.
Note that only upscaling by a factor of 2 is supported.
